The method of diagnosing ADHD is a complex process. There is no clear definition of the symptoms, and no test can be used to determine ADHD. Many conditions, such as anxiety, autism and PTSD are able to look similar to ADHD, and about the same percentage of people suffering from the disorder also have a mental health condition that is a part of it. Before any medication can be prescribed, a complete mental health assessment must be performed.

You will discuss your care plans with your therapist following your evaluation. This could mean continuing care at the specialist centre or shared care with your GP or discharge back to your GP.

Some private assessments do not require the approval of your doctor. It is important to confirm this with the provider before you book, especially if you are interested in sharing care or returning discharge to your GP.

It is important to keep in mind that adults suffering from ADHD often get misdiagnosed. In some cases, symptoms of ADHD could be misinterpreted as depressions, anxiety disorders or bipolar disorder. These conditions may require a different treatment than ADHD, so it's important to find a psychiatrist who specializes in adult ADHD and is aware of the distinctions between these disorders.

Psychiatrists and psychologists conduct private ADHD assessments with psychologists and psychiatrists. They are the only ones who are licensed to diagnose ADHD in the UK. The assessment can be conducted in person via phone, in person or through video. The typical assessment lasts between 45 to 90 minutes, and will focus on your mental health history as well as family-related mental health issues.
